Taking Stock: Markets trim losses after sharp sell-off; Sensex down 332 pts, Nifty below 23,800
Indian equity benchmarks experienced a pullback in afternoon trade, recovering some of the sharp losses seen earlier in the session. The BSE Sensex slipped 332 points, while the Nifty 50 index slipped below the 23,800 mark, indicating continued volatility in the broader market.
